Franciscan Health | Healthcare | 20000 | $3.6B | United States | Phenom | Phenom TalentCube | Video Interviewing | 2023 | n/a | In 2023, Franciscan Health implemented Phenom TalentCube to modernize high-volume healthcare recruiting. The deployment emphasized Video Interviewing capabilities within Phenom's Intelligent Talent Experience and was rolled out across Franciscan Health hospitals in Indiana. The implementation centered on asynchronous one-way video interviews and interviewer review workflows, using Phenom TalentCube as the underlying video capability to capture and surface candidate interview recordings. Configuration focused on screening and evaluation workflows consistent with Video Interviewing platforms, enabling recruiter and hiring manager review queues and standardized evaluation rubrics. Operational scope covered HR recruiting teams across the Indiana hospital network, with the solution embedded into frontline hiring processes for high-volume clinical and nonclinical roles. Governance included centralized interview orchestration and standardized reviewer workflows to improve throughput in candidate screening. Franciscan Health reported a reduction in time to hire by 13 days and $73 million in agency spend savings associated with the intelligent video interviewing rollout. These outcomes were tied directly to the Phenom TalentCube Video Interviewing implementation and the broader Intelligent Talent Experience. | |

Life Time | Leisure and Hospitality | 43000 | $2.6B | United States | Phenom | Phenom TalentCube | Video Interviewing | 2023 | n/a | In 2023 Life Time implemented Phenom TalentCube as part of a broader Phenom TXM deployment to improve career site, CRM, and recruiting workflows focused on high volume frontline hiring. The initial rollout included testing of Phenom one way video interviews to support asynchronous candidate assessments and screening within the talent acquisition funnel. Phenom TalentCube, classified in the Video Interviewing category, was applied to enable video assessments and one way interview workflows alongside career site optimization and CRM driven candidate engagement. The Phenom TXM configuration emphasized candidate facing talent experience, recruiter workflow automation, and asynchronous screening capabilities. The implementation covered HR and talent acquisition functions supporting frontline hiring and was operated in conjunction with career site and CRM workflows to drive candidate pipelines. The case study notes Life Time tested video assessments during the rollout, and Phenom’s prior acquisition of TalentCube indicates the video interviewing capability is likely delivered via TalentCube technology. Governance followed a phased testing and adoption approach for frontline roles, aligning recruiter processes and CRM engagement rules to accept asynchronous video submissions and move screened candidates into downstream recruiting workflows. The deployment produced double digit increases in unique leads, job seekers, and career site visits while video interviews remained in test phases, reflecting expanded pipeline generation tied to the Phenom TalentCube Video Interviewing capability. | |

ScribeAmerica | Professional Services | 25000 | $3.2B | United States | Phenom | Phenom TalentCube | Video Interviewing | 2023 | n/a | In 2023 ScribeAmerica adopted Phenom TalentCube for Video Interviewing to support high volume hiring in its HR organization. The deployment centered on Phenom One Way Video Assessments, and the company completed roughly 30,000 video assessments within six months, demonstrating rapid operational adoption for candidate screening. The implementation used TalentCube powered one way video interview capability as the primary module, embedding asynchronous video screening into requisition workflows and recruiter queues. Functional configuration emphasized candidate submitted video responses, structured assessment templates, and centralized reviewer workflows to enable scalable screening and consistent evaluation criteria across hiring teams. Governance changes focused on integrating the video assessment stage into standard hiring processes, assigning recruiter review responsibilities, and standardizing assessment templates and evaluation timelines to increase throughput. Outcomes explicitly reported by the company include improved screening efficiency, fewer unnecessary live interviews, and increased recruiter throughput following the rollout of Phenom TalentCube for Video Interviewing. |
